Property | Organism | Value | Units | ID | Details |
---|---|---|---|---|---|
Percent of microbiota that belong to the phyla Bacteroidetes or Firmicutes | Human Homo sapiens | > 99 | % | 109671 | Rawls, J. F., Mahowald... |
Generation time in mouse large intestine | Bacteria Escherichia coli | 40-80 | min | 105657 | Peekhaus N, Conway T.... |
Pie charts of median values of bacterial genera present in fecal samples of African and European children | Human Homo sapiens | Graph - link | % | 111321 | De Filippo C. et al.... |
Number of species out of 400 to 500 human intestinal microbial species that account for 99% of the total population | Human Homo sapiens | 30 - 40 | species | 117017 | Breitbart M et al., ... |
Effectiveness of treating obesity | Human Homo sapiens | most treatments (typical maximal weight loss) <10%: obesity surgery (sustained weight loss) ≤50% | % | 117251 | Berthoud HR. The vagus nerve... |
Normal doubling time in human intestinal tract | Bacteria Escherichia coli | 40 | hours | 102096 | Michael A. Savageau, 1983... |
Ratio between number of microbial cells and number of animal cells in body | Human Homo sapiens | 10 (outdated, updated value is 1.3, see comments section) | unitless | 102391 | Savage DC. Microbial... |
Selected data of macroscopic dimensions of intestine | Human Homo sapiens | Table - link | N/A | 111124 | Helander HF, Fändriks... |
Fraction of bacteria out of faecal solids in persons living on Western diets | Human Homo sapiens | ~55 (equivalent to 18 g of bacterial dry matter) | % | 112838 | G. T. Macfarlane and... |
Description of the numerically predominant anaerobes that occur in the large intestine | Human Homo sapiens | Table - link | Log10(g dry wt.)^-1 | 112839 | G. T. Macfarlane and... |
Polysaccharidase and glycosidase activities in different fractions of human faeces | Human Homo sapiens | Table - link | N/A | 112840 | G. T. Macfarlane and... |
Doubling time in the laboratory | Bacteria Syntrophobacter fumaroxidans | 140 | hours | 115542 | Gibson B, Wilson DJ, Feil E... |
Average mass of bacterium in stool | Human Homo sapiens | 4.6 | pg | 112998 | Sender R, Fuchs S, Milo... |
Total dry weight of bacteria in body | Human Homo sapiens | ~50-100 | g | 112999 | Sender R, Fuchs S, Milo... |
Genome-scale metabolic models of human-related microorganisms and human tissues | Human Homo sapiens | Table - link | N/A | 107408 | Karlsson FH, Nookaew I... |
First appearance of mammals on the world stage and time when most modern mammalian species arose | Mammals | first appearance ~160Ma: most modern species arose 1.8Ma - present | million years ago (Ma) | 112853 | Ley RE et al., Evolution... |
Diversity of bacteria in Barrett’s oesophagus | Human Homo sapiens | Firmicutes 55%: Proteobacteria 20%: Bacteroidetes 14%: Fusobacteria 9%: Actinobacteria 2% | % | 112310 | Rubio CA. The Natural... |
Turnover time of whole squamous epithelial cell lineage | Metazoa animals | ~7.5 | days | 112303 | Karam SM, Lineage commitment... |
Concentration of planctomycetes (a phylum of aquatic bacteria) in P3 alkaline compartment of hindgut | Termite Cubitermes ugandensis | ≤2.6e+9 | planctomycetes/ml | 104952 | Köhler T, Stingl U, Meuser K... |
Highest nucleotide substitution rate | Virus Microviridae spp. | >1 | substitution/105 nts/day | 110709 | Minot S, Bryson A, Chehoud C... |
